We have friends going to Disneyland at the end of this week.
They are arriving on Friday and their first day in the parks will be Saturday.
Their E-Ticket itinerary indicates "CityPass may be picked up at any Main Entrance Ticket Window or at the Guest Services complex to the left of the Disneyland Park Main Entrance"
So my questions is can they pick up their CityPass on Friday even if they are not planning to enter the park until Saturday?
 
I am going by memory of a few years ago, but as I recall, the ticket booth tears out the citibook voucher, and gives a 3 day hopper, which was not activated until we went through the gate.

So, it would be worthwhile to give it a try on the Friday night before, ask the question. If nothing has changed then you are good to go on Saturday morn. If not, then you know to get to the park earlier the next day.

I would send the majority of the group to the gate line and one person stand in the ticket line, if I had to do it in the morning.
